Cold Iron (Kindle Edition)
By Charles V. Henely
Review & Description
Henry Mullins had spent the last four years studying hard, and now that
he was about to graduate from engineering school he was finally getting
a social life. But his initiation into a role playing game didn't go
quite the way he expected. The bed-sheet toga didn't cause him any problems,
but the dive knife strapped to his leg was a major problem, but it was
also the key to his success in a new world.
The magical system of Cold Iron is based on the premise from Kipling's poem Cold Iron, “But Iron -- Cold Iron -- is master of them all.” Iron controls all the elements, and by using his iron a magician can manipulate the world around him. But, iron is anathema to the locals so that they are only able to deal with very small amount before suffering from iron poisoning, leading to painful and ugly death. Enter Henry Mullins, an engineering student from Earth, who not only has no problems with iron poisoning (after all, his earthly metabolism requires it and the hemoglobin in his blood contains it) but has a background in chemistry and physics. Science and technology as known on earth barely exist on Maath, where steel is totally unknown and magic has kept the physical sciences from being a priority. With no limit to how much iron he can use and a strong background in Earth science and technology, Henry, now known as Iron Hank, is able to create a variety of brute force spells to overcome the forces of evil that had been bearing down on his new home.
